Cabbage Creek
Cabbage Creek is a stream in Putnam, Florida. Cabbage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Lands End Ranch, as well as near Orange Springs.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Edgar
Hamlet
Edgar is an unincorporated community in Putnam County, Florida, United States, located southwest of the town of Interlachen. Edgar is located along Putnam County Road 20A east of Crossley, Florida, and has a former Atlantic Coast Line Railroad spur leading to what is today the CSX Wildwood Subdivision. Edgar is situated 3½ miles north of Cabbage Creek.
